Output ec158689fb264e1677157d9d443d74aacf826e0240412216c411d587c8c42fda:0
- value
- 59168
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de28cc7b88137eafb6eafea6b35ebeaeb8e3c835 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FftLND29YXDdpX5GEnjtq9djtjadcCxp
- transaction
- ec158689fb264e1677157d9d443d74aacf826e0240412216c411d587c8c42fda
- confirmations
- 439137
- spent
- true